LAILA

LAILA is a platform that uses AI to help with research, marketing, and customer service. It uses smart AI and machine learning to give useful information and make business tasks easier. LAILA is made for teams that move fast and want clear results, with no need for technical setup. It helps make products better, use resources wisely, and allows for endless testing until the desired results are achieved. Use Cases LAILA can be used in many ways to improve different parts of business operations. For research and testing ideas, LAILA helps gather useful information and refine ideas before launch. In marketing, LAILA finds the best channels, makes ad spending better, and personalizes messages to connect with consumers. For customer service, LAILA offers smart and personalized communication, works well with many platforms, and manages bookings across locations easily. LAILA is great for digital media agencies, product and brand managers, and incubators and accelerators. It helps these professionals make workflows easier, save time and money, and make better decisions.
